    The Government is investing an extra £20 billion a year in the NHS. The NHS has produced a ‘Long Term Plan’ setting out the things it wants health services to do better for people across the country. Whilst the national plan has set some clear goals, it’s up to local areas to decide how they’re achieved – that means engaging with local people and listening to their experiences and expectations of current and future services.
